
As excitement builds for Big Bash League (BBL) Season 15, the league’s first overseas player draft has officially been announced, and the list is packed with global T20 superstars. On Tuesday, BBL organizers unveiled the initial group of 10 international cricketers eligible for selection—and the names certainly raised eyebrows.
Pakistan captain Mohammad Rizwan, pace sensation Shaheen Shah Afridi, fiery fast bowler Haris Rauf, and dynamic all-rounder Shadab Khan headline a powerful Pakistan contingent ready to light up Australia’s biggest T20 stage. This elite group joins international stars such as Sam Curran, Alex Hales, Lockie Ferguson, Tim Southee, Kusal Perera, and Shamar Joseph in the draft pool.
When you talk about consistency and composure in white-ball cricket, few can match Mohammad Rizwan. As Pakistan’s all-format captain and one of the most reliable T20 openers in the world, Rizwan brings a wealth of experience and a reputation for guiding run chases with surgical precision.
Rizwan has previously played in major franchise tournaments, including the Pakistan Super League (PSL), and made a significant impact in England’s T20 Blast. Now, as he prepares to enter the BBL through this draft, he brings with him not only class but also a chance to grow his global fanbase in Australia.
No conversation around T20 pace bowling is complete without Shaheen Shah Afridi. The left-arm quick has built a fearsome reputation for destroying top orders early in the powerplay, and his ability to swing the new ball at pace makes him one of the most dangerous bowlers in the format.
Afridi previously played for Melbourne Stars in the BBL and made his presence felt with his aggressive approach. As he returns to the draft, BBL franchises will be eager to secure his services and use his express pace to rattle opposition batters under the lights.
Another familiar face for BBL fans, Haris Rauf rose to prominence in Australia. He debuted for Melbourne Stars during BBL 09 and quickly became a fan favorite after delivering fiery spells and claiming a hat-trick. Since then, he has become a T20 globetrotter, making headlines in every league he participates in.
With his incredible yorkers and variations, Rauf provides the X-factor that any team craves in the death overs. His return to the BBL draft signals his intent to continue making Australia a second home.
Shadab Khan, Pakistan’s premier white-ball spinner and utility player, rounds out the country’s four-man squad in the first draft list. Shadab adds immense value as a leg-spinner who can bat anywhere in the order, making him a highly versatile T20 player.
He’s impressed in the Caribbean Premier League, PSL, and The Hundred, and BBL teams looking to strengthen their spin options will see Shadab as a priority pick in this draft.

In a stroke of luck, Brisbane Heat—the BBL 13 runners-up—have drawn the first pick in this year’s overseas draft. That means they’ll get first dibs on any of the 10 marquee players revealed so far. Whether they go with the explosive Rizwan, the fearsome Afridi, or the experienced Curran remains to be seen.
The June 19 draft promises to be a game-changer for team strategies, as franchises aim to balance local core strength with international stardust.
This overseas draft format ensures transparency, fairness, and balance in squad construction. Instead of behind-the-scenes negotiations, fans can now witness a structured and televised player selection process—much like the IPL auction or The Hundred Draft.
It also increases global engagement, as players from across continents wait to see which team will secure their services.
